Output 52df8e964cfe40ed23ceaff03de6c528eacf0c1379ccf050da5e3bef312f47c1:0

value
259678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5735f3adfd68373e71d9a81132dfc0a26a3c3b OP_EQUAL
address
37HMckiSg38HqwUUhKXEGtejTyaL3nUUYt
transaction
52df8e964cfe40ed23ceaff03de6c528eacf0c1379ccf050da5e3bef312f47c1
spent
true